Market overview
The commercial security market is highly fragmented, with competition driven by the balance between regional service responsiveness and national technical capabilities. Decision factors typically include system integration complexity, monitoring reliability, and the ability to scale security infrastructure across multiple geographic locations.

The Uniting Church is a major Christian denomination in Australia, formed through the union of Methodist, Presbyterian, and Congregational churches. It provides a wide range of spiritual, educational, and social welfare services across the country.
